Transaction cc4bf765548c723e1e928f4e24cfc3352b5e90470c7f67fa9a0f2e20e1d32ba0

block
1c3520e0e03d65e0143f2b47048ceec4d09b54e209265bdb656cfc35a7bead94

1 Input

23 Outputs